## Health Checks

Heads up, support folks: the Brindlecast API sits behind the Mossgate balancer, and nodes only get traffic after three clean probes. If customers report flapping, it's usually probe timeouts, not the app. Before escalating to the platform crew, check these against what's deployed. Current tuning values are as follows.

tuning constants:
QUOTAS = {
    "druwyn": 5,
    "holix": 5,
    "zorath": 5,
    "holwyn": 10,
}

Finance Review Summary — Hedging Decision

Reviewed Q3 exposure on the Velran crown following the Osterfeld expansion. Forward contracts locked for 70% of projected receivables; remainder floats per Tavrin's model. Cost of carry acceptable; downside capped at tolerance threshold. No objections from treasury. Decision stands through year-end unless volatility doubles. The strategic rationale behind the partial hedge is noted below.

confidential, bahop-hahif: Only 3 of the 140 pilot accounts renewed Oliath, so a churn review is set for July 15.

## Who to ping about GiftNote

Welcome aboard! GiftNote is our donation-receipt mailer for the Larchfield Fund. Template tweaks go to the comms folks; delivery failures and bounce weirdness go to the platform crew. Don't push template changes on Fridays — receipts batch over the weekend. For anything GiftNote-related, start with the address below.

billing contact of kaweg-tajeg = drudor.lamion.oliath@torvalabs.test